One name that immediately springs to mind is Mark Schwarzer. Although retired, Schwarzer had a long and successful career in the Premier League, playing for clubs like Middlesbrough, Fulham, Chelsea, and Leicester City. His shot-stopping ability and commanding presence in the box made him a respected figure among fans and fellow players alike. Schwarzer's longevity in the Premier League is a testament to his professionalism and dedication to the sport. Another notable player is Tim Cahill. Known for his aerial prowess and knack for scoring crucial goals, Cahill spent a significant portion of his career at Everton, where he became a fan favorite. His passion, work rate, and commitment to the team endeared him to the Everton faithful, and he remains a beloved figure at Goodison Park. One prominent example is Robbie Kruse. Known for his speed, agility, and dribbling skills, Kruse has played for several Bundesliga clubs, including Fortuna Düsseldorf and VfL Bochum. His ability to take on defenders and create scoring opportunities has made him a valuable asset to his teams. Kruse's experience in the Bundesliga has also helped him to become a key player for the Australian national team, the Socceroos. Another notable player is Mathew Leckie. Leckie has been a consistent performer in the Bundesliga, playing for clubs like FC Ingolstadt and Hertha BSC. His versatility, work rate, and ability to play in multiple positions have made him a valuable asset to his teams. Leckie's contributions to his clubs have not gone unnoticed, and he has earned the respect of fans and coaches alike.
